C#在word中插入富文本
下面是一个示例代码,可以在C#中使用Microsoft.Office.Interop.Word库在Word文档中插入富文本:
using Microsoft.Office.Interop.Word;
// 创建Word文档对象
Application wordApp = new Application();
Document wordDoc = wordApp.Documents.Add();
// 插入富文本
Range range = wordDoc.Range();
range.Text = "这是一段富文本。";
range.Font.Bold = 1;
range.Font.Italic = 1;
range.Font.Underline = WdUnderline.wdUnderlineSingle;
// 保存并关闭Word文档
object filename = @"C:\example.docx";
wordDoc.SaveAs2(ref filename);
wordDoc.Close();
wordApp.Quit();
在上面的代码中,我们使用了Microsoft.Office.Interop.Word库来创建一个Word文档对象,然后使用Range对象在文档中插入富文本。在这个例子中,我们将文本加粗、斜体和下划线,并将其保存为example.docx文件
原文地址: https://www.cveoy.top/t/topic/dpQt 著作权归作者所有。请勿转载和采集!